White: Milk is typically a white or pale-yellowish liquid.
Creamy: Describing the smooth, rich consistency of milk.
Smooth: Refers to the lack of lumps or clumping in the milk.
Thick: Used for milk products like cream, where the water content is reduced.
Thin: Describes milk with a higher water content, like skim milk.
